Have got a Zoostorm netbook and am having a problem connecting to wi-fi.
When I siwtch on the netbook it always connects automatically to my broadband.This past couple of days it shows when I switch it on I get the message " No network connection availible".
Tried the troubleshooting mode and it detects that "Wi-Fi capability is switched off" and says to use switch on side or back of computer to turn it on.
Cant find any switch on the side or back and as far as my limited knowledge goes , have been pressing F2 (as this has the symbol of a wi-fi ?)
Is there anything I am doing wrong or should I be looking elsewhere for a button
